Capacitive proximity sensors detect objects without physical contact by sensing changes in electrostatic fields, and they are widely used in consumer electronics, automotive systems, food and beverage processing, and industrial automation. The global market is valued at approximately $2.9 billion in 2025 and is projected to grow to around $4.1 billion by 2030, at a compound annual growth rate of roughly 7-8 percent. Growth is driven by the proliferation of smart devices, increasing automation in manufacturing, and rising demand for non-contact detection solutions across multiple industries.

Market Overview

Capacitive proximity sensors represent a significant segment within the broader global sensors market, which is valued at over $212 billion in 2025. Unlike inductive sensors that detect only metal objects, capacitive sensors can sense both metallic and non-metallic materials, including liquids and solids, giving them a wider range of applications. Their ability to function through non-metallic barriers and their resistance to harsh environments such as dust, moisture, and vibration make them ideal for industrial and commercial use.

Growth Drivers

The rapid expansion of industrial automation under Industry 4.0 initiatives is a primary catalyst, as factories increasingly deploy non-contact sensing solutions for quality control, object detection, and level monitoring. Consumer electronics demand, particularly for touch-enabled smartphones, tablets, and wearable devices, also fuels market growth by requiring precise capacitive detection technology. Additionally, the automotive industry's shift toward electric and autonomous vehicles is driving adoption for applications such as seat occupancy detection, interior lighting control, and fluid level sensing.

Segmentation and Regional Analysis

The market is segmented by sensor type into shielded and unshielded variants, with shielded sensors suited for compact mounting environments and unshielded sensors offering longer detection ranges. End-user industries span automotive, food and beverage, pharmaceuticals, packaging, aerospace, and consumer electronics. Geographically, Asia-Pacific dominates due to strong manufacturing activity in China, Japan, South Korea, and India, while North America and Europe follow with steady growth supported by advanced automation and automotive production.

Trends and Outlook

What are the recent trends and outlook?

Miniaturization and the integration of capacitive sensors with wireless and IoT-enabled platforms are emerging as key trends, enabling smarter monitoring and predictive maintenance in industrial environments. The broader sensors industry, which includes capacitive proximity devices, is expected to grow from $212.5 billion in 2025 to $323.3 billion by 2030, reflecting widespread digitization across sectors. Ongoing miniaturization and cost reduction, combined with the rise of smart factories and connected devices, position the capacitive proximity sensor market for sustained expansion through the end of the decade.
